3つの結合ツインケージの制御された自己組み立てと多刺激応答の相互変換

まとめ
研究者はパラジウムと新しいリガンドを使って 新しいツインケージを作りました 溶媒の選択は,相互接続されたまたは同位体ケージの形成を制御し,スマート素材の刺激反応変換を示します.
科学分野:
- 超分子化学
- 協調化学
- 材料科学
背景:
- 超分子構造における刺激に反応する構造的変容は,スマートな機能的材料の開発の鍵です.
- 生物学的過程を模倣するための 分子プラットフォームを提供します
研究 の 目的:
- 双子ケージの 制御された自己組み立てを報告する
- これらの複雑な超分子構造の間の刺激反応構造変換を調査する.
主な方法:
- シスブロックされたパラジウムコーナーと自己組み立てのための新しいビスビデントリガンドを使用した.
- 自己組み立て過程で様々な溶媒によって制御されたケージ形成.
- 温度,溶媒の変化,ゲストの封じ込めによって引き起こされる構造的変換を調査した.
主要な成果:
- トポロジ的に前例のない3つの結合ツインケージを成功裏に合成しました: 1つの接着されたPd12L6ケージ (2) と2つのヘリコイソメリックPd6L3ケージ (3と4).
- 溶剤制御による選択的形成は,相互に繋がったケージ2または同位体ケージ3と4の混合物である.
- ヘリケートベースの双子ケージ3と4の間の温度,溶媒,およびゲスト誘発の構造的相互変換を展示しました.
結論:
- 複合的でトポロジ的にユニークなツインケージ構造の制御された自己組み立てを達成しました.
- 異なる超分子構造間の刺激反応変換を確立した.
- この研究は,ダイナミックな超分子システムに基づいた切り替え可能な機能的材料の設計のための基礎を提供します.

Cooperative Allosteric Transitions
7.4K
Cooperative allosteric transitions can occur in multimeric proteins, where each subunit of the protein has its own ligand-binding site. When a ligand binds to any of these subunits, it triggers a conformational change that affects the binding sites in the other subunits; this can change the affinity of the other sites for their respective ligands. In aerobic fermentations, oxygen is vital for microbial growth and metabolite production. Since air comprises only about 20% oxygen and the gas is poorly soluble in water—just 9 ppm at 20°C—supplying sufficient oxygen becomes a critical challenge, especially in high-demand processes like yeast growth or citric acid production.
